Greenleaf Trust Acquires 97 Shares of Watsco, Inc. (NYSE:WSO)

Greenleaf Trust increased its holdings in shares of Watsco, Inc. (NYSE:WSOFree Report) by 11.6%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 932 shares of the construction company’s stock after purchasing an additional 97 shares during the quarter. Greenleaf Trust’s holdings in Watsco were worth $442,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Watsco

(Free Report)

Watsco,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the distribution of air conditioning, heating, refrigeration equipment, and related parts and supplies in the United States and internationally. The company distributes equipment, including residential ducted and ductless air conditioners, such as gas, electric, and oil furnaces; commercial air conditioning and heating equipment systems; and other specialized equipment.
